Almotamar.net - Deputy parliament speaker for legislative and monitoring affairs Akram Attiyah said Saturday the parliament would send the constitutional amendments proposed by the president of the republic the moment they are received to specialised committees to study them and submit a report for discussion at the parliament to finalise the constitutional and legal procedures.

Although al-Attiyah affirmed that the parliament is not concerned with differences of parties in Yemen because it functions its role according to constitutional and legal texts he on the other hand wished that there would be accord by parties on the amendments.

The deputy speaker said the special committee composed of the rights and constitutional committees has begun its meetings concerning the amendments of the elections law and took measures that would result on the form of amendments very soon.
